Gooi Poh Hong is LHoL’s Programme Director with over 30 years of English teaching and learning development experience. Her work experience ranges from being a classroom teacher in secondary schools in Malaysia, to being the head of various proficiency English programmes in a leading university in Malaysia. Prior to her appointment with LHoL, she was teaching proficiency English courses in Universiti Sains Malaysia (USM) catering to undergraduates, postgraduates as well as corporate learners. She has also taught intensive English courses to local and foreign students with very little background and exposure to the English language. Poh Hong has also been actively involved in developing teaching materials for a variety of proficiency English courses offered in the university. She is most enthusiastic about classroom pedagogy and has written story books and workbooks for pre-schoolers as well as activity books for primary school children.

Intan Darlina Muhammad is one of LHoL’s Lead Instructors who is passionate about teaching and working with people. Darlina graduated with Honours from the University of Kent, Canterbury, England with a Bachelor of Arts in English Studies. She achieved the inaugural prestigious award of Anugerah Dekan Matrikulasi ESL from Universiti Malaya back in 2000 and 2001. Darlina is not new to the community as you may remember her delivering the English News Bulletins for Traxx.fm as well as news and traffic updates for Time Highway Radio. In her free time, Darlina masters corporate ceremonies and state functions as well as delivers the Parliament Report for Dewan Negara and Dewan Rakyat. Darlina is currently an Enterprise Risk Management Practitioner and an Associate Trainer for Emergency Response/ Business Continuity in the airline industry.

Susanne Buetikofer is one of our instructors.
She has over a decade of experience in the travel and hospitality industry and is recognised for her sophistication and savoir-faire. Susanne is also an extremely passionate and enthusiastic instructor who has worked with frontline and customer service teams during her tenure in a national full service carrier for Switzerland and a luxury brand hotel in New York City, United States. In Swissair, she spent many years in Customer Service where she worked on developing good communication and presentation skills with her teams. In the Swissôtel The Drake she worked as a Front Office Manager, and constantly promoted her role to train and build confidence in her team in reinforcing work ethics and value systems that prioritised quality customer service. In the latter part of her career, after having managed a Swiss Hotel in Koh Samui, Thailand she then returned to Switzerland and undertook further training to become a Human Resources Specialist.
Susanne worked for several years for the Swiss Secretariat for Economic Affairs and conducted many recruitment and human resources related workshops during this time. Susanne graduated with Honours from the Hotel Management School of Geneva, Switzerland. She is currently living with her family in Taiwan and is completing her Master Certificate in Strategic Human Resources Management at the Michigan State University, United States. Susanne is well travelled and is fluent in English, French and German.
